This extra time can cause problems in sweeps and other test sequences in which measurement
timing is critical. To avoid the extra time for the reference measurements in these situations, the OFF
selection can be used to disable the automatic reference measurements. Note that with automatic
reference measurements disabled, the instrument may gradually drift out of specification.
To minimize the drift, a reference and zero measurement should be made immediately before the
critical test sequence. The ONCE setting can be used to force a refresh of the reference and zero
measurements used for the current aperture setting.
Autozero settings
Autozero setting Description
OFF Turns automatic reference measurements off.
ONCE After immediately taking one reference and one zero measurement, turns
automatic reference measurements off.
AUTO Automatically takes new acquisitions when the Model 2657A determines
reference and zero values are out-of-date.
Front-panel autozero
To change autozero from the front panel:
1. Press the CONFIG key.
2. Press the MEAS key.
3. Turn the navigation wheel to select AUTO-ZERO, and then press the ENTER key or the
navigation wheel .
4. Turn the navigation wheel to select the mode (OFF, ONCE, or AUTO), and then press the
ENTER key or the navigation wheel .
5. Press the EXIT (LOCAL) key to return to the main display.
Remote command autozero
To set autozero from a remote interface:
Use the autozero command with the appropriate option shown in the following table to set autozero
through a remote interface (see smuX.measure.autozero
(on page 7-195)). For example, send the
following command to activate automatic reference measurements:
smua.measure.autozero = smua.AUTOZERO_AUTO
Autozero command and options
Command Description
smua.measure.autozero = smua.AUTOZERO_OFF
Disable autozero*
smua.measure.autozero = smua.AUTOZERO_ONCE
After immediately taking one reference and one zero
measurement, turns automatic reference measurements
off.
smua.measure.autozero = smua.AUTOZERO_AUTO
Takes new acquisitions when a measurement is made
and reference and zero values are out-of-date.
* Old NPLC cache values will be used when autozero is disabled (see NPLC caching (on page 2-24)).
